Lot 1
Historic Environment Scotland is seeking a Contractor to warehouse and distribute publications produced by the Historic Environment Scotland. The publications must be stored in the correct environment and the contractor must have a commitment to the highest standards of stock handling. The Contractor must have the capability to receive international deliveries and international orders and provide book handling skills including but not limited to re-jacketing books and quality checking of printed books.
Renewal: The Contract will cover the period from 21st May 2018 to 20th May 2020 with 1 (one) option to extend for an additional 24 months. The maximum contract period will therefore be 4 (four) years dependent upon satisfactory completion of all aspects of the contract to date.

Open Contracting Data Standard (OCDS)
The Open Contracting Data Standard (OCDS) is a framework designed to increase transparency and access to public procurement data in the public sector. It is widely used by governments and organisations worldwide to report on procurement processes and contracts.
